What Are the Akashic Records?

 

The Akashic Records are often described as the energetic memory field of the soul.

A space where the deeper blueprint of your consciousness exists.

The Records carry:

  • karmic patterns
  • emotional imprints
  • ancestral influences
  • soul lessons
  • unresolved experiences
  • spiritual gifts
  • fears
  • possibilities
  • and the deeper purpose behind your incarnation

When an Akashic Records reader accesses your Records, they are not simply “predicting the future” or giving motivational advice.

Through prayer, energetic attunement, intuition, and spiritual permission, the reader begins accessing the deeper energetic patterns operating beneath your life.

Sometimes this information comes through:

  • intuitive knowing
  • emotions
  • visions
  • symbols
  • spirit guide messages
  • repeated themes
  • bodily sensations
  • or deep inner clarity

And what makes the Akashic Records powerful is this:

they do not only tell you what is happening.

They begin revealing why it is happening.

And often, that changes a person’s entire relationship with their life.

How Do the Akashic Records Reveal Soul Purpose?

 

Most people imagine soul purpose very narrowly.

They think:
“My soul purpose must be one specific career.”
Or:
“My soul purpose must be one big achievement.”

But souls are far more layered than that.

You do not take birth only to become a doctor, entrepreneur, spiritual teacher, artist, or healer.

Those may become expressions of your purpose.

But your real soul purpose is the deeper lesson your consciousness came here to experience.

And the Akashic Records reveal this through the patterns of your life.

The Records Reveal Soul Purpose Through Repetition

 

One of the clearest ways the soul communicates is through repeated emotional themes.

The soul repeats experiences until awareness develops.

So if the same emotional pattern keeps appearing in different forms, the Records begin showing the deeper lesson beneath the repetition.

 

For example:
someone may repeatedly experience abandonment in relationships.

From the surface, it may appear that they simply keep meeting the “wrong people.”

 

But the Records may reveal that the soul is actually trying to learn:

  • self-worth
  • emotional independence
  • boundaries
  • faith
  • and the ability to stop seeking identity through another person

Another person may repeatedly experience situations where they are forced into leadership and responsibility, even when they resist visibility.

The Records may reveal that their soul chose leadership as a path of evolution.

Someone else may constantly feel emotionally disconnected from a highly successful life. They may earn well, perform well, and still feel empty internally.

The Records may reveal that the soul is seeking meaning, emotional truth, spirituality, creativity, healing, or inner alignment beyond material success.

The Akashic Records connect your experiences to your evolution.

And suddenly, life stops feeling random.

Sometimes Your Deepest Wound Is Connected to Your Soul Purpose

 

This surprises many people.

Because we assume soul purpose should always feel exciting or glamorous.

But often, the greatest lessons of the soul come through the experiences that break us open emotionally.

I once worked with a woman whose twenty-one-year-old son died unexpectedly.

Before that, she had what most people would call a good life. She was intelligent, successful, emotionally stable, respected, and deeply connected to her son. And then one event shattered the structure of her entire reality.

After his death, she kept asking:

“What is the purpose of my life now?”

And truthfully, no human explanation can ever make the loss of a child feel “acceptable.”

But when we entered the Akashic Records, a deeper lesson slowly began revealing itself.

Her soul purpose was not merely achievement or stability.

One of the deepest themes of her incarnation was acceptance.

Not ordinary acceptance.

But acceptance of what human beings cannot control.

Acceptance of death.
Acceptance of impermanence.
Acceptance of life moving beyond our personal will.

Her son’s soul had entered her life with immense love, but not necessarily for a long earthly journey. Through that loss, her soul was being initiated into surrender, compassion, emotional depth, and eventually service.

Years later, she began helping others experiencing grief and emotional breakdown.

Her pain became a doorway into healing for others.

That too is soul purpose.

Not punishment.
Not cruelty.

But soul evolution through experience.

Some Souls Come Here to Learn Forgiveness

 

There are also souls whose primary lesson becomes forgiveness.

These are often people surrounded by betrayal, emotional hurt, abandonment, lies, abuse, broken trust, and repeated disappointment.

Again and again, life asks them:
Can you remain open-hearted without becoming bitter?

Can you forgive without becoming weak?

Can you release resentment without losing wisdom?

Forgiveness does not mean tolerating abuse.
It does not mean lacking boundaries.

It means refusing to let pain poison your consciousness permanently.

And for some souls, this becomes one of the deepest spiritual lessons of their incarnation.

What Could Be Your Soul Purpose?

 

One of the simplest ways to begin understanding your soul purpose is to ask yourself:

What has been the overarching pattern of my life?

Because the soul usually teaches through repetition.

The lesson may change faces, places, jobs, and relationships — but the emotional theme often remains the same until consciousness develops around it.

And interestingly, your soul purpose is often the opposite of the wound you have repeatedly experienced.

For example:

  • If your life has been filled with betrayal and broken trust, perhaps your soul purpose is learning faith — faith in yourself, faith in life, faith beyond control.
  • If your life has constantly forced you into responsibility and leadership, perhaps your soul purpose is stepping into power consciously instead of shrinking from it.
  • If you have repeatedly experienced rejection or invisibility, perhaps your soul purpose is voice, self-worth, and learning to be seen authentically.
  • If your life has been filled with grief and loss, perhaps your soul is learning surrender, compassion, and emotional resilience.
  • If you are surrounded by difficult family dynamics, addictions, ancestral wounds, or emotional heaviness, perhaps your soul purpose is becoming the one who transforms the lineage consciously.
  • If spirituality, intuition, healing, psychology, energy work, or deeper truths keep pulling you despite your practical mind resisting it, your soul purpose may involve awakening spiritual intelligence and helping others through it.

And sometimes, purpose is simpler than people imagine.

Sometimes your purpose is learning joy.
Learning love.
Learning peace.
Learning to rest.
Learning to receive.
